
How does Matlab calculate settling time?

How does Matlab calculate settling time?

By default, the rise time is the time the response takes to rise from 10\% to 90\% of the way from the initial value to the steady-state value ( RT = [0.1 0.9] ). The upper threshold RT(2) is also used to calculate SettlingMin and SettlingMax .

How PID controller gains are calculated?

The transfer function of a PID controller is found by taking the Laplace transform of Equation (1). = derivative gain. C = s^2 + s + 1 ———– s Continuous-time transfer function. C = 1 Kp + Ki * — + Kd * s s with Kp = 1, Ki = 1, Kd = 1 Continuous-time PID controller in parallel form.

How do you calculate settling time?

To calculate settling time, we consider a first order system with unit step response. Now, calculate the value for A1 and A2….How to Calculate Settling Time.

Second-order System Damping Ratio (ξ) Setting Time (TS)
Underdamped 0<ξ<1
Undamped ξ = 0
Critical damped ξ = 1
Overdamp ξ > 1 Depends on dominant pole

How does Matlab calculate rise time?

Determine the rise time, reference-level instants, and reference levels. [R,lt,ut,ll,ul] = risetime(x,t); Plot the waveform with the lower- and upper-reference levels and reference-level instants. Show that the rise time is the difference between the upper- and lower-reference level instants.

READ ALSO:   How do you get a stock buy signal?

How do you solve settling time?

How do you determine the value of PID?

Manual PID tuning is done by setting the reset time to its maximum value and the rate to zero and increasing the gain until the loop oscillates at a constant amplitude. (When the response to an error correction occurs quickly a larger gain can be used. If response is slow a relatively small gain is desirable).